+/**
|
|
|
+ * hdd_process_defer_disconnect() - Handle the deferred disconnect
|
|
|
+ * @adapter: HDD Adapter
|
|
|
+ *
|
|
|
+ * If roaming is in progress and there is a request to
|
|
|
+ * disconnect the session, then it is deferred. Once
|
|
|
+ * roaming is complete/aborted, then this routine is
|
|
|
+ * used to resume the disconnect that was deferred
|
|
|
+ *
|
|
|
+ * Return: None
|
|
|
+ */
|
|
|
+void hdd_process_defer_disconnect(hdd_adapter_t *adapter)
|
|
|
+{
|
|
|
+ switch (adapter->defer_disconnect) {
|
|
|
+ case DEFER_DISCONNECT_CFG80211_DISCONNECT:
|
|
|
+ adapter->defer_disconnect = 0;
|
|
|
+ wlan_hdd_disconnect(adapter,
|
|
|
+ adapter->cfg80211_disconnect_reason);
|
|
|
+ break;
|
|
|
+ case DEFER_DISCONNECT_TRY_DISCONNECT:
|
|
|
+ wlan_hdd_try_disconnect(adapter);
|
|
|
+ adapter->defer_disconnect = 0;
|
|
|
+ break;
|
|
|
+ default:
|
|
|
+ hdd_info("Invalid source to defer:%d. Hence not handling it",
|
|
|
+ adapter->defer_disconnect);
|
|
|
+ break;
|
|
|
+ }
|
|
|
+}
